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
½ cup of butter
1½ cups of graham crumbs
1 package of flaked coconut (200 g)
1 can of eagle brand condensed milk
1 package of semi-sweet chocolate chips
½ cup of creamy peanut butter

Directions:
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350º (or 325º for glass dish). In a 9 x 13 baking dish, melt butter in oven. Sprinkle crumbs evenly over butter; mix together and press into pan. Top evenly with coconut, then condensed milk. Bake 25 minutes or until lightly browned. In small saucepan over low heat, melt chips with peanut butter. Spread evenly over hot coconut layer. Cool 30 minutes; chill, then cut into bars. Store loosely covered at room temperature.
